summ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orDavid Xu2023-12-15 22:52:11 +0800
committerDavid Xu2023-12-15 22:52:11 +0800
commit0b8a9ac92bca0566787df0296409af8a64a4ec0c (patch)
tree6e235c4d0122f47b4a9fef761b8947efd3eb4393
downloadaur-0b8a9ac92bca0566787df0296409af8a64a4ec0c.tar.gz
swift-mesonlsp-bin: Binary version of
swift-mesonlsp, a language server for meson.
-rw-r--r--.SRCINFO11
-rw-r--r--PKGBUILD17
2 files changed, 28 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..8a4b21793267
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,11 @@
+pkgbase = swift-mesonlsp-bin
+ pkgdesc = A language server for meson
+ pkgver = 3.1.3
+ pkgrel = 1
+ url = https://github.com/JCWasmx86/Swift-MesonLSP
+ arch = x86_64
+ license = GPL3
+ source = https://github.com/JCWasmx86/Swift-MesonLSP/releases/download/v3.1.3/Swift-MesonLSP.zip
+ sha256sums = aef1f6b386e517ac31e58286b25c6bd828ad1fc1e6958a18d5cd52a868bdf1aa
+
+pkgname = swift-mesonlsp-bin
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..5253f916d2ea
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,17 @@
+pkgname=swift-mesonlsp-bin
+_pkgname=Swift-MesonLSP
+pkgver=3.1.3
+pkgrel=1
+pkgdesc="A language server for meson"
+arch=("x86_64")
+url="https://github.com/JCWasmx86/Swift-MesonLSP"
+license=("GPL3")
+makedepends=()
+source=("https://github.com/JCWasmx86/Swift-MesonLSP/releases/download/v${pkgver}/${_pkgname}.zip")
+sha256sums=('aef1f6b386e517ac31e58286b25c6bd828ad1fc1e6958a18d5cd52a868bdf1aa')
+
+
+package() {
+ install -D ${srcdir}/${_pkgname} ${pkgdir}/usr/bin/${_pkgname}
+ install -Dm644 ${srcdir}/COPYING ${pkgdir}/usr/share/licenses/${_pkgname}/COPYING
+}